When Britain lost the American Revolution they ceded all of the land from the Atlantic Ocean west to what physical feature in th
Ad libitum [116K]

Answer:

East of Mississippi River

Explanation:

Treaty of Paris was an agreement signed between the United States of America and Great Britain in 1783 after the American Revolutionary War. It was signed to show and depict the full independence of America and its territory.

Article one of the treaty made mentioned the freedom of all thirteen colonies, while article two created the boundaries of the United States which span right from all of the lands from the Atlantic Ocean west to the EAST OF MISSISSIPPI RIVER.
